> Commit b10effb92e27 ("e1000e: fix buffer overrun while the I219 is
> processing DMA transactions") imposes roughly 30% performance penalty.
>
> The commit log states that "Disabling TSO eliminates performance loss
> for TCP traffic without a noticeable impact on CPU performance", so
> let's disable TSO by default to regain the loss.
